Address

ecash:qr58dntrk3whq06a56lphlwe9fl2wxnetgwdsp6vz2Copy

Total Received

6647247.7 XEC

Total Sent

6647247.7 XEC

№ Transactions

99

Final Balance

0 XEC

Transactions
Filter